Plus, he shares the importance of understanding the needs of your skin.What we discuss:[00:02:25] Why skin cell turnover is crucial for maintaining healthy skin [00:03:15] Chemical vs. mechanical exfoliation[00:04:08] The benefits of proper exfoliation[00:08:22] Why understanding the needs of your skin is essentialKey Takeaways:Exfoliation plays an important role in enhancing the absorption and effectiveness of skincare products. By removing the layer of dead skin cells on the surface of your skin, exfoliation allows the active ingredients in skincare products to penetrate more deeply and work more effectively. This means that your moisturizers, serums, and treatments can better target and address specific skin concerns, resulting in improved overall skincare results.There are two primary types of exfoliation: mechanical and chemical. Mechanical or physical exfoliation entails physically scrubbing the skin using an abrasive substance. In contrast, chemical exfoliation involves using ingredients such as acids or enzymes that dissolve the glue binding the dead skin cells together.Understanding the specific requirements of your skin is vital for effective exfoliation. Oily skin, for instance, often faces issues like excessive dead skin cells and clogged pores. Frequent exfoliation can be beneficial in maintaining a clearer complexion for oily skin types.
